If ATF is filled, only use ATF available as a replacement part.
- If the ATF level is checked, the seal - arrow - of the ATF inspection plug must always be replaced.
ATF Level, Checking
- Turn off engine.
The ATF temperature must not be more than approximately 30 °C at start of test.
• Transmission not emergency running, ATF temperature not above approximately 30° C
• Vehicles is horizontal
• Selector level at "P"
- Connect tester and move through selections until it is ready for operation => [ Tester, Connecting ] 09G Transmission.
- Press right Guided Functions.
- Then select vehicle, transmission and Check ATF Level.
- Press ->.
- Start engine.
- Raise vehicle.
- Place appropriate receptacle underneath transmission.
- Press ->.
If test temperature: 35 °C to 45 °C is shown:
- Remove locking bolt in oil pan to check ATF.
The ATF present in the overflow tube runs off.
If ATF continues to leak out of hole:
ATF does not need to be topped off.
- Tighten sealing plug with new seal to 15 Nm. The ATF check is now completed.
If no ATF drips from the hole:
- Top off ATF => [ ATF, Filling ] ATF, Filling.
